Output 18288c45d8046c45732b30177f45ee011b1e7da56a56eea96d4b8942ecd42dd4:1

value
27154936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f912a6fe1c84cb5ee8aec83dda6c8df6192929b0 OP_EQUAL
address
3QPzXJ4wFHaniuzwAxGuCBNz4kkH19dX23
transaction
18288c45d8046c45732b30177f45ee011b1e7da56a56eea96d4b8942ecd42dd4
confirmations
332963
spent
true